The mid Summer heat has arrived, so we’re releasing a seasonal beer to quench your thirst.
Inspired by the search for wild food and a slower way of living, we’re calling it The Forager. Each year, we’ll change up the recipe, gathering herbs and spices from the forest floor of our Northern Rivers region to add to the brew.
The 2016 release is a Belgian Style Witbier, brewed with coriander and bitter orange. Expect wild fruitiness, mild tartness and subtle spice that finished dry and crisp, to cool you down and refresh your palate.

Davros (5279) reviewed The Forager from Stone & Wood Brewing Co 10 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 7 | Flavor - 6 | Texture - 6 | Overall - 6.5
Pours straw with a quickly fading head.Nose shows orange peel, doughy wheat and soft floral notes.Flavours include more doughy wheat and a soft cardboard note along with some orange peel.
